Transaction 944658baa28857373878c09703ced3afe781d065d6137f9e4f6bc17998a54878
1 Input
1 Output
-
944658baa28857373878c09703ced3afe781d065d6137f9e4f6bc17998a54878:0
- value
- 21989
- script pubkey
- OP_0 OP_PUSHBYTES_32 7e4f5ee34adde99d9bc28f94f0648131d5b36511acbc973086c0cfc587d4c9bb
- address
- bc1q0e84ac62mh5emx7z3720qeypx82mxeg34j7fwvyxcr8utp75exass9myss